How can teachers support diverse learners? Teachers and other specialists are often searching to find creative ways to reach learners at all levels. By incorporating technology that is already available in the classroom, educators can empower students to independently access supports whenever they may need them. When use of these tools becomes part of the ‘norm’, it becomes easier for all learners, including those with disabilities, to utilize these tools and take control of their learning. We will discuss some recommended practices for leveraging these tools to help address learner variability and promote expert learners.This session will highlight accessibility features that are built-in to Chrome OS, iOS, and Windows devices to support reading tasks, writing tasks, computer access and more. Short video examples will highlight a variety of potential options across platforms!
